Top ERP Systems – Microsoft Dynamics AX vs NAV vs GP vs SL

The modern workplace is discovering the need for an (ERP) software system to streamline operations and increase the opportunity for a company’s departments to collaborate, thereby reducing unnecessary work flow. One company that has been gaining attention from industry experts is Microsoft Dynamics, which has four ERP lines: Microsoft Dynamics GP, NAV and SL, for small and medium-sized businesses, and AX for mid-sized and large companies.
